Experts Predict Quantum Leap In Abia North District’s GDP

Experts have predicted a significant increase in Abia North district’s Gross Domestic Product (GDP) over the next 12 months due to enhanced access to markets, revival of agro-assets, and general ease of movement.

Governor Alex Otti stated this in Uzuakoli, Bende local government area as he continued his commissioning of projects executed by his administration within its first two years in office.

He said, “Our administration has outlined the district as strategic to its realization of agro-transformation agenda, which targets sustainable food security, job creation, and enhanced foreign revenue for the state.”

He said the administration had created opportunities for people to achieve personal growth and self-actualisation through significant investments in infrastructure, social services, and other critical sectors

“We are deliberately investing in infrastructure that closes the gap between rural and urban communities and eliminates the push factors for rural-urban migration,” the governor explained

He described the recently commissioned 67.6km Umuahia–Uzuakoli–Abiriba–Ohafia Joe Irukwu Way, as a transformative infrastructure development expected to spur economic growth.

Otti, who had earlier commissioned the newly reconstructed and fully equipped Ngwu Uzuakoli Primary Health Centre, said in the past 29 days alone, he had commissioned 23 new projects.
